US general 'pleased' with Iraqi troops' response

Gen. John Abizaid, chief of US Central Command, said Saturday he was "very, very pleased" with the response of Iraqi armed forces in containing recent sectarian bloodshed, disputing critics who said too little was done to quell attacks that killed more than 500 people the past week. Abizaid spent two days in Baghdad meeting with top Iraqi leaders after the Feb. 22 bombing of a golden-domed Shi'ite shrine in Samarra triggered reprisal attacks against Sunnis that pushed the country to the brink of civil war.
